Nicolas L. Ziebarth
Assistant Professor
Economics
W344
John Pappajohn Bus Bldg
The University of Iowa, Iowa City, IA 52242-1994
Ph: 319-335-3810
Fax: 319-335-1956
E-mail:
nicolas-ziebarth@uiowa.edu
Website
 
CV
Academic History
PhD in Economics, Northwestern University, 2012
MA in Economics, Norhwestern University, 2007
BA Honors in Economics, Mathematics, and Philosophy, University of Wisconsin - Madison, 2005
Awards
Finalist for Nevins Prize, Economic History Association, 2012
Sokoloff Graduate Fellowship, Economic History Association, 2011
Robert Eisner Memorial Fellowship, Department of Economics, Northwestern University, October 2011
Selected Publications
Dissertation Summary: "Essays on the Great Depression from a Micro-Perspective",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Journal of Economic History - Publication Details Forthcoming
Are China and India backwards? Evidence from the 19th century U.S. Census of Manufac- tures,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Review of Economic Dynamics, vol 16, 2013, 86-99
Identifying the effects of bank failures from a natural experiment in Mississippi during the Great Depression,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, AEJ: Macroeconomics, vol 5, 2013, 81-101
A Troublesome Statistic: Traders and the Westward Movement of Slaves, Richard H. Steckel, Nicolas L. Ziebarth
The evolution of resistance to two-toxin pyramid transgenic crops, Anthony R. Ives, Paul Glaum,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Dave A. Andow, , Ecological Applications, vol 21, 2011, 503-515
Analysis of Ecological Time Series with ARMA(p; q) models,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Anthony R. Ives, Karen Abbot, Ecology, vol 91, 2010, 858-871
Weak population regulation in ecological time series,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Karen C. Abbot, Anthony R. Ives, , Ecology Letters, vol 13, 2010, 21-31
The structure and stability of model ecosystems assembled in a variable environment,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Anthony R. Ives, Oikos, vol 114, 2006
EVOLUTION OF PERIODICITY IN PERIODICAL CICADAS, Nicolas L. Ziebarth, Paul P. Heideman, Rebecca A. Shapiro, Sonia L. Stoddart, Chien Ching Lilian Hsiao, Gordon R. Stephenson, Paul A. Milewski, Anthony R Ives, , Ecology, vol 86, 2005, 3200-3211
